Also, several years ago we bought a commercial double fridge for hte kitchen. Arctic Air brand. Made in china, sold from a company in Minnesota. It's 2-3/4 years old and has a freon leak. R290.... and it happens on thanksgiving weekend.... so we took a chest freezer we just got on FB marketplace and I fond an "inkbird" thermostat in my junk box... we now have a Freezerator to get us thru to next week when we can get an HVAC guy out. I decided last night while we've got it all torn apart, I'll add a Shelly module to it with 5 temperature sensors and power measurement. From now on I'll trend it's run time and Hi and low side temperatures.

Planted 3x custard apple trees about 1 year old, horse radish, Jerusalem Artichokes, wormwood, 2x Rosemary Have 1 x canna edulus up, 2x turmeric up, 1x ginger up and 3 more horseradish up - these all in containers. Bought 150 onion sets last week for R100 and planted them. I cut their leaves down to just above the junction and freeze them. This gives you the green onion tops. As the onions grow we cut the tops for our kitchen. Raw in salads or cook in food. Good flavour. The onion bulbs themselves are a bonus when matured for harvesting. Same with sweet potatoes. Cut the greens to cook like cabbage/spinach. One 🍠 sweet potato can give you months of greens instead of just 1 tuber. I planted about 15 potatoes and 2 sprouted bulbs of garlic this morning. Want to see how they do in this new bed in afternoon shade. Have been unsuccessful everywhere else in the garden.
